Accountant's Office
Jan. 3d 1797
I certify that there is due Mr Michael G. Houston, Ordnance and Military Storekeeper at Albany, the sum of Ninety Dollars, being for his Salary from the 1st of Octr to the 31st of Decr 1796 inclusive, which sum is payable to Samuel Hodgdon per Order.
[Also copied in the Official Book]
Ds 90 Wm Simmons

Capt. Frederick Frye Accountant's Office
Governor's Island Jan. 3d 1797
New York
Sir
I recd your letter of the 2d Inst. enclosing the Pay & Muster Roll of your Detachment for Decr 1796, which have been examined and after adding eight cents to the Pay of Patrick Powers (he being charged in pay Roll [short] that sum) amounts to Four hundred seven Dollars & sixty eight Cents, which sum you will receive from Nicholas Fisk Esqr Supt New York, on giving him duplicate Receipts for the due application thereof.
I am &c.
Wm Simmons
Acct
